Manga ( 漫画) are comics creat ed in Japan, or by Japanese creat ors in t he Japanese language,
conforming t o a st yle developed in Japan in t he lat e 19t h cent ury.[1] The t erm is also now used
for a variet y of ot her works in t he st yle of or influenced by t he Japanese comics. The product ion
of manga in many forms remains ext remely prolific, so a single list covering all t he not able works
would not be a useful document . Accordingly, coverage is divided int o t he many relat ed list s
below.
